Bonjour
J' ai essayé ce code pour rapatrier sur un classeur les valeurs d'une
page Web entière, code qui ne fonctionne pas. La fin de la ligne Http
m'est personnelle, elle ouvre bien quand elle est sur la barre d'adresse
de FF; mais voila en vba il ne se passe rien. J'ose espérer qu'il y ai
une astuce que qq connait peut être sur Mpfe.
Public Sub ChercheWebSource()
Dim Dlgn As Byte
Dim Adweb$
Dlgn = [A50].End(3).Row
Sheets("Import").Select
[A:A].ClearContents
Adweb =
"http://www.msn.com/fr-fr/finance/liste-de-valeurs/fi-38723d2b-f58c-4cc7-9112-b7965bxxxxx"
With Sheets("Import").QueryTables.Add(Connection:=Adweb,
Destination:=Range("A1"))
.Name = "MSN Com"
.FieldNames = True
.RowNumbers = False
.FillAdjacentFormulas = False
.PreserveFormatting = True
.RefreshOnFileOpen = False
.BackgroundQuery = False
.RefreshStyle = xlOverwriteCells
.SavePassword = False
.SaveData = True
.AdjustColumnWidth = False
.RefreshPeriod = 0
.WebSelectionType = xlEntirePage
.WebFormatting = xlWebFormattingNone
.WebPreFormattedTextToColumns = True
.WebConsecutiveDelimitersAsOne = True
.WebSingleBlockTextImport = False
.WebDisableDateRecognition = False
.WebDisableRedirections = False
.Refresh BackgroundQuery:=False
End With
End Sub
Cette action est irreversible, confirmez la suppression du commentaire ?
Signaler le commentaire
Veuillez sélectionner un problème
Nudité
Violence
Harcèlement
Fraude
Vente illégale
Discours haineux
Terrorisme
Autre
JièL
Hello,
je serais tenté de dire qu'il manque la connexion au compte MS. Dans le navigateur il y a une connexion qui doit se faire pour accéder à la partie personnelle, je ne pense pas qu'elle se fasse à partir d'excel
-- JièL Connecté
Le 24/07/2015 11:57, Fredo P. a écrit :
Bonjour J' ai essayé ce code pour rapatrier sur un classeur les valeurs d'une page Web entière, code qui ne fonctionne pas. La fin de la ligne Http m'est personnelle, elle ouvre bien quand elle est sur la barre d'adresse de FF; mais voila en vba il ne se passe rien. J'ose espérer qu'il y ai une astuce que qq connait peut être sur Mpfe.
je serais tenté de dire qu'il manque la connexion au compte MS.
Dans le navigateur il y a une connexion qui doit se faire pour accéder à
la partie personnelle, je ne pense pas qu'elle se fasse à partir d'excel
--
JièL Connecté
Le 24/07/2015 11:57, Fredo P. a écrit :
Bonjour
J' ai essayé ce code pour rapatrier sur un classeur les valeurs d'une
page Web entière, code qui ne fonctionne pas. La fin de la ligne Http
m'est personnelle, elle ouvre bien quand elle est sur la barre d'adresse
de FF; mais voila en vba il ne se passe rien. J'ose espérer qu'il y ai
une astuce que qq connait peut être sur Mpfe.
Public Sub ChercheWebSource()
Dim Dlgn As Byte
Dim Adweb$
Dlgn = [A50].End(3).Row
Sheets("Import").Select
[A:A].ClearContents
Adweb > "http://www.msn.com/fr-fr/finance/liste-de-valeurs/fi-38723d2b-f58c-4cc7-9112-b7965bxxxxx"
je serais tenté de dire qu'il manque la connexion au compte MS. Dans le navigateur il y a une connexion qui doit se faire pour accéder à la partie personnelle, je ne pense pas qu'elle se fasse à partir d'excel
-- JièL Connecté
Le 24/07/2015 11:57, Fredo P. a écrit :
Bonjour J' ai essayé ce code pour rapatrier sur un classeur les valeurs d'une page Web entière, code qui ne fonctionne pas. La fin de la ligne Http m'est personnelle, elle ouvre bien quand elle est sur la barre d'adresse de FF; mais voila en vba il ne se passe rien. J'ose espérer qu'il y ai une astuce que qq connait peut être sur Mpfe.